1. Bridging the Gap between Employers and Employees
One of the primary roles of fish and chip shop assistant staff agencies is to bridge the gap between employers seeking reliable workers and individuals looking for employment opportunities. These agencies act as a connection point, matching the skills and availability of potential employees with the requirements and needs of fish and chip shop owners.
By having an agency as an intermediary, employers can save time and effort by not having to screen and interview numerous candidates individually. Instead, agencies conduct the initial screening process to select suitable candidates based on specific criteria set by the employers. This not only ensures that only qualified and capable individuals are considered for employment but also streamlines the hiring process for fish and chip shop owners.
On the other hand, employees benefit from the services of these agencies by gaining access to a wide range of job opportunities across various fish and chip shops in London. The agencies provide them with valuable assistance in finding employment, reducing the stress and burden often associated with job hunting.

3. Ensuring Flexibility in Staffing
Flexibility in staffing is crucial for fish and chip shop owners, especially during peak hours or busy periods. Fish and chip shop assistant staff agencies play a vital role in ensuring this flexibility by providing access to a pool of temporary and part-time workers.
During weekends, holidays, or seasonal rushes, fish and chip shops often experience an increase in customer demand. This can create staffing challenges as owners may struggle to find sufficient workers to handle the workload. By partnering with assistant staff agencies, fish and chip shop owners can tap into a network of individuals who are available for short-term or part-time positions.
This flexibility enables employers to meet the fluctuating demands of their business while maintaining the quality of their products and services. It also provides opportunities for individuals seeking part-time employment or those with other commitments who can only work during specific hours or on specific days.
